What is everyone else loading in their .308win for hunting.

Currently loading

165gr hornady interlocks (flat base, no boat tail) @ 2.750” oal
44.5 grains of varget
Seeing about 2700 fps average at 0C
(32f)

Took a >350 lb black bear with this load, never recovered the bullet, pass through.
 
150 grain Barnes TSX Boat tail
46.0 Grains IMR 4064 (Top end of safe pressures in my rifle. Make sure to work up any load in your rifle.)
2940 FPS average at 70 F.

A few Mule deer, Elk out to 480 yards. and an antelope.

Any close range hunts with the Barnes load?
 
Any close range hunts with the Barnes load?
One deer was shot inside 50 yards. Double lung pass thru. The bullet appeared to have doubled in size with a larger exit wound. Deer got back up, ran thirty yards or so and tipped over. Most of the others were shot between one hundred to two hundred yards out. None required a difficult tracking job. Most dead right there.
